Abstract
A detachable, reversible vehicle seat adjustable lengthwise by controls on its slides, has a manual locking system for each of the slides, including a manual control handle articulated to one of the ends of each slide near the anchoring area of a leg of the seat, the ends being different on the two slides for a given seat, and a transverse connecting shaft articulated near the front legs below the base of the seat, one of whose ends is designed to cooperate with a manual control handle controlling the unlocking of one of the slides, while the other end of the transverse connecting shaft has a finger able to cooperate with the unlocking means of the other slide in its runner.
